Angelcorpse was a blackened death metal band formed in Kansas City in 1995 by Gene Palubicki and Pete Helmkamp. Regarding the band's name, Pete Helmkamp stated in an interview; "We put it as two words on the demo, so Osmose learned it that way. But that was just a mistake at the printers...It was one of those flukes. But it is just a single word... It just seems to look more visually pleasing as a single word. It fits with the phonetics: we say 'Angelcorpse', not 'Angel Corpse'."
